What is entry level corporate event planning?

Entry level corporate event planning involves assisting in the organization and execution of business events such as conferences, meetings, trade shows, and company parties. Professionals in this role typically handle tasks like coordinating logistics, communicating with vendors, managing event materials, and supporting senior planners. It's a great starting point for those interested in the event management industry, offering hands-on experience while developing organizational and communication skills. Entry level planners often work directly with teams to ensure events run smoothly and meet company objectives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level corporate event planner,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Corporate Event Planner,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and a relevant degree or coursework in hospitality, business, or communications. Familiarity with event management software (like Cvent or Eventbrite), Microsoft Office Suite, and budgeting tools is often required. Exceptional communication, problem-solving skills, and adaptability help you excel in collaborating with vendors, clients, and team members. These skills and qualities are crucial for executing seamless events that meet client expectations and organizational goals.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level corporate event planners, and how can they overcome them?

Entry-level corporate event planners often encounter challenges such as managing tight deadlines, juggling multiple tasks, and coordinating with various vendors and stakeholders. Learning effective time management and organizational skills is crucial to staying on top of event details. Building strong communication with team members and vendors helps prevent misunderstandings and keeps projects on track. Seeking mentorship from experienced planners and being proactive in asking questions can also ease the transition into this fast-paced environment.
